About Us

The Middle East and North Africa club at Yale SOM is dedicated to being a space for students of the various countries that make up the MENA region with the goal of connecting members to the intersection of the business, social, and cultural aspects of the region.Through events centered around music, food, holidays, identity, and more, the club aims to increase the MENA presence at SOM. Our 50-plus student clubs are an integral part of the Yale SOM community. Clubs provide forums for discussion and opportunities for action, and they foster students' leadership and business skills via consulting engagements, workshops, roundtables, conferences, and fundraisers. SOM clubs are inclusive networks open to all students to participate as identifying members or as active allies.
